ショウジンブログ

Learn as if you will live forever, Live as if you will die tomorrow.

投稿においてデフォルトのカテゴリを指定する@WordPress

Sponsored Links

WordPressにはインストール段階で「未分類」というカテゴリがあります。

カテゴリは投稿には必ずつけられるものなので、指定していない場合にはこのデフォルトの「未分類」となります。

「未分類」でもいいんですが、うっかり適切なカテゴリを指定せずに投稿していて、この「未分類」になってたりすると、かっこ悪い時もあります。

投稿頻度の高いカテゴリ名や汎用的なカテゴリ名(例:お知らせ、ニュース、その他)にこの「未分類」を変えておくのもひとつの手ですが、そうではない場合、任意のカテゴリ名をデフォルトに設定したい場合には以下のコードを使用しているテーマのfunctions.phpに記述します。

<?php

/* 投稿においてカテゴリはデフォルトで「お知らせ」を設定
============================================= */
function my_head() {
echo
'<script type="text/javascript">
jQuery(document).ready(function($){
$("input#in-category-8").attr("checked", "checked"); // カテゴリIDを指定
});
</script>';
}
add_action('admin_head', 'my_head');

カテゴリIDは管理画面からそのカテゴリの編集画面に進み、ブラウザのURLバーを確認します。

f:id:showjinx:20160604183450p:plain

category&tag_ID=8

の「8」の部分ですね。

小さな会社のWordPressサイト制作・運営ガイド (Small Business Support)

小さな会社のWordPressサイト制作・運営ガイド (Small Business Support)